Sci Simple

New Science Research Articles Everyday

「アクティベーション」とはどういう意味ですか?

目次

アクティベーションは、ディープラーニングモデル、特にニューラルネットワークがどう機能するかの重要な部分なんだ。モデルが入力データを処理するとき、いろんな層を通過してデータを計算したり変換したりする。それぞれの層には自分なりのパラメータがあって、モデルが学習するにつれて更新されるんだ。アクティベーションは、ニューロンが「発火」するかどうかを決めるもので、受け取った入力に基づいているんだ。

アクティベーションの仕組み

アクティベーションをネットワーク内の信号みたいに考えてみて。データがネットワークを通過すると、各ニューロンがどう反応するかを決める。これは、受け取った入力に関数を適用することで行われるんだ。出力があるレベルを超えると、ニューロンはアクティブになって、下回ると静かにしてる。このプロセスがモデルにパターンを理解させて、意思決定を助けるんだ。

アクティベーションの重要性

アクティベーションは、モデルがデータから重要な特徴を学ぶのを助ける。例えば、画像処理では、特定のアクティベーションがエッジや形、色を認識するのに役立つことがある。これは、画像分類や物体検出みたいなタスクにとって重要なんだ。

アクティベーションの分析

これらのアクティベーションパターンを研究することで、研究者はモデルがデータをどれだけうまく解釈しているかを知ることができる。それに、モデルのどの部分がうまく機能しているか、どの部分が調整が必要かを特定するのにも役立つ。この分析は、言語理解や視覚的タスクなど、さまざまなアプリケーションでのパフォーマンス向上につながるんだ。

モデル性能の向上

アクティベーションを調整することで、モデルのパフォーマンスを向上させることができるよ。アクティベーションをファインチューニングしたり、機能を変更したりする技術があって、これがモデルのタスクへの適応を助けるんだ。これによって、精度や効率が向上して、実際のシナリオでより役立つモデルになるよ。

まとめ

要するに、アクティベーションはディープラーニングモデルの基礎的な要素で、情報の処理方法において重要な役割を果たしてる。アクティベーションを理解し分析することが、モデル開発や応用の進展につながるから、多くの研究者や実践者にとって重要な焦点になっているんだ。

アクティベーション に関する最新の記事